Quite the Runout for Knick
Level 4
: Blinds 300/500, 500 ante
Tony Knick limped in early position, Kashka Corpening raised to 1,600 in middle position, and James Priest flatted in the cutoff. Knick decided to come along for the ride.
On the flop of 4♠10♣7♦, it checked to Priest, who bet 3,000, resulting in calls from both of his opponents.
The 4♦ fell on the turn and it checked to Priest again, who bet 7,500. Only Knick continued to the 8♦ river.
Knick led out for 15,000 and after a brief moment of thought, Priest flicked in the call.
"Straight flush," announced Knick, as he turned over 6♦5♦.
